高产能籽瓜破碎取籽机的改进及试验 被引量:4

摘要 高产能籽瓜破碎取籽机是籽加工过程中的关键设备,可一次性完成籽瓜瓜籽、瓜瓤和瓜皮的分离.根据目前机型存在的产能低,瓜籽的损失率大,脱净率、洁净率低等问题,对取籽机的关键部件破碎辊和一级破碎分离装置中的分离辊进行改进设计.在破碎辊轴上安装扁刃型瓜刀,并在瓜刀下方设有刀砧,瓜刀能迅速抓住下落的籽瓜并将其强制向下切成两瓣.分离辊根据人手掏瓜的动作,采用仿生手结构.针对整机性能的影响因素进行正交试验,采用模糊综合评价法对试验结果进行分析,结果表明,影响整机性能的因素主次顺序为:分离辊锥度>一级破碎分离装置主轴转速>分离辊与主轴角度>破碎辊转速.优选参数组合为:破碎辊的转速45r/min、分离辊锥度2°、一级破碎分离装置主轴转速98.5r/min、仿生手结构辊刀与主轴角度12°.重复试验表明,该破碎取籽机的瓜籽损失率<1%,瓜籽脱净率>98%,洁净率>98%,可满足籽瓜加工的指标要求. High capacity and crushing seed melon machine is the key equipment in the seed production line.It can completely separate seeds,flesh and melons by one time.According to the problems of low efficiency and clean rate and high seed loss rate,the improved design was carried out on the key components of the seed machine,the crushing roller and separation roller in the crushing separation device.On the crushing roller,flat blades and anvil knife were installed,the blades could quickly grasp seed melon and squeeze it into two pieces.The separation roller using bionic hand structure,modeling people's action,which could dig melon flesh and pull them out.According to the effecting factors on the working ability of the machine,the orthogonal experiment was performed and the fuzzy comprehensive evaluation method was used to analyze the test results.The results showed that the factors affecting the overall performance of the machine taking the order of separating roller taper,a crusher spindle speed separation apparatus,a separation roller and the spindle rotation angle and the crushing roller.The combination of parameters were as follows,crushing roller speed was 45r/min,the separation roller taper was 2°,the spindle speed of the separation device was 98.5r/min,bionic hand structure roller cutter and the spindle angle was 12°.Repeat tests showed that the loss rate of the seed crushing machines was less than 1 %,the net rate was higher than 98%,clean rate was higher than 98%,meeting the requirements of watermelon index processing.
